Milwaukee is located to the west of the great freshwater Lake Michigan, on a drainage basin formed by ancient glaciers, the development of marshland and the cultivation of earth. An interstate system of highways meets here, then spreads to the west, south and north. People live here and travel through from other places. Commercial flights race over the lake or across the western counties. From the air, in spring and summer, trees obscure the view below, hiding streetlights, industry, backyards and highways. Birds rest here as they migrate north and south, traveling through passageways over water and land. At night, geese reflect the wasted light from below, glowing and calling as they drift. Monarch butterflies visit. In early summer they stop and feed on milkweed, lay their eggs and move on. In September they stop again, heading south.
